Weather in April

April, like March, is another pleasant spring month in Gabu, Japan, with temperature in the range of an average low of 19.9°C (67.8°F) and an average high of 22.3°C (72.1°F).

Temperature

April observes an average high-temperature of a still pleasant 22.3°C (72.1°F), marking an insignificant difference from March's 20.3°C (68.5°F). Gabu documents a consistent average low-temperature of 19.9°C (67.8°F) at night during April.

Humidity

In Gabu, Japan, the average relative humidity in April is 77%.

Rainfall

In Gabu, during April, the rain falls for 16.7 days and regularly aggregates up to 104mm (4.09") of precipitation. Throughout the year, in Gabu, there are 229.8 rainfall days, and 1512mm (59.53")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

The average length of the day in April is 12h and 48min.
On the first day of April in Gabu, sunrise is at 06:18 and sunset at 18:45.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 05:50 and sunset at 18:59 JST.

Sunshine

In April, the average sunshine is 6.7h.

UV index

In April, the average daily maximum UV index is 6.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
Note: During April, 6 as the daily maximum UV index converts into the following advice:
Undertake protective measures and comply with sun safety rules. Shielding against skin and eye damage is essential. Between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the Sun emits the most powerful UV radiation. Limit direct exposure to the Sun during these hours. Stay sun-safe with clothing that is both closely woven and worn loosely.
